Sony has announced a new line of collectible PlayStation figurines.
Created in collaboration with toy company Spin Master, The Shapes Collection is a new line of collectibles based onPlayStationStudios franchises includingGod of War, Horizon andGhost of Tsushima.
“The highly detailed figures deliver the interactive storytelling element of these titles in an all-new way, extending the gaming experience from digital to physical,”saidGrace Chen, vice president, global marketing at PlayStation.

“This creative line takes inspiration from details in each game, with interchangeable accessories and dozens of points of articulation to pose and display each figure in your collection of memorabilia.”
The first figurine in the collection to be released will be a six-inch model based on Aloy fromHorizon Forbidden West, and it’s available to pre-order now for $49.99 / £48.

Upcoming figures based on Varl from Horizon Forbidden West, Jin Sakai from Ghost of Tsushima, and Kratos and Atreus fromGod of War Ragnarökwill be available to pre-order on July 15, priced at $29.99 / £28.80.

They’re being sold through PlayStation Gear where available, andAmazonin the US and Australia.
